Linux磁盘管理(一)

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档


前言

磁盘管理是一项使用计算机时的常规任务,Windows 2000 Server的磁盘管理任务是以一组磁盘管理应用程序的形式提供给用户的,它们位于“计算机管理”控制台中,包括查错程序、磁盘碎片整理程序、磁盘整理程序等。


一、磁盘管理概述

(一)、磁盘的表示方法

1.磁盘的表示方法
(1)/dev/hd 接口类型为IDE的磁盘
(2)/dev/sd 接口类型为SCSI的磁盘

2.磁盘中的分区表示
(1)主分区:/dev/sda1 /dev/sda2
/dev/sda3 /dev/sda4
(2)扩展分区
逻辑分区表示: /dev/sda5 /dev/sda6 … /dev/sda26

(二)、分区类型

1.MVR
(1)只能划分4个主分区,且磁盘容量小于2TB
(2)主分区(4个)
(3)扩展分区、逻辑分区

2.GPT
理论上可以无限个分区、1支持磁盘容量大于2TB的分区划分

(三)、文件系统和类型

1.文件系统
操作系统组织文件的管理方法

2.文件系统的类型
(1)XFS:Linux7之后的系统默认文件系统

(2)EXT 4|3|2:Linux7之前的系统默认文件系统

(3)SWAP:交换分区,当物理内存不足时,临时充当内存使用,防止系统崩溃,容量为物理内存大小

在这里插入图片描述
在这里插入图片描述

(四)、物理内存大小

1.inode节点内容
(1) inode 编号
(2)用来识别文件类型
(3) 文件的链接数目
(4) 属主的ID (UID)
(5) 属组 ID (GID)
(6) 文件的大小
(7) 文件所使用的磁盘块的实际数目
(8) 最近一次修改的时间
(9) 最近一次访问的时间
(10) 最近一次更改的时间

2.Linux查找文件过程
(1)系统找到这个文件名对应的inode号码
(2)通过inode号码,获取inode信息
(3)根据inode信息,找到文件数据所在的block,读出数据

3.文件名与inode的区别
(1)对于系统来说,文件名只是inode号码便于识别的别称或绰号
(2)文件名包含特殊字符,无法正常删除。这时,直接删除inode节点,就能起到删除作用
(3)移动文件或重命名文件,只是改变文件名,不影响inode号码
(4)打开一个文件以后,系统就以inode号码来识别这个文件,不再考虑文件名。因此,通常来说,系统无法从inode号码得知文件名
在这里插入图片描述

例子
1.当磁盘容量不足时操作系统无法打开应用程序
2.磁盘inode节点消耗殆尽时操作系统重启后无法正常进去系统
3./tmp/.X0-lock 无法创建或者关机时没有被删除时操作系统进入不了图形界面

二、磁盘操作

(一)、磁盘查看

(1)fdisk -l
(2)lsblk

(二)、添加磁盘

linux添加磁盘后默认不识别,需要重启终端或者热扫描(for i in ls /sys/class/scsi_host;do echo “- - -” > $i/scan;done)查看是否成功
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

(三)、分区

fdisk
不支持2tb以上的磁盘

1.交互式
fdisk /dev/sdb

2.交互式命令
p:打印分区情况
在这里插入图片描述

n:新建分区
(1)Select (default p):设置分区类型
(2)分区号 (3,4,默认 3):设置分区号
(3)起始 扇区 (4196352-41943039,默认为 4196352):设置容量起始扇区,一般都是默认
(4)Last 扇区, +扇区 or +size{K,M,G} (4196352-41943039,默认为 41943039):设置容量大小,一般采用+size
(5)W:保存退出

n的字命令
(1)p:创建主分区
(2)e:创建扩展分区
(3)e的子命令:创建逻辑分区(l)
在这里插入图片描述
在这里插入图片描述

l:列出分区类型标识
(1)82:swap分区
(2)83:linux基本分区
(3)8e: LVM逻辑卷
在这里插入图片描述

t:修改分区类型标识
在这里插入图片描述

d:删除分区
在这里插入图片描述

w:保存分区并退出
在这里插入图片描述

q:不保存退出

3.非交互式
(1)vim part.txt:第一行n;第二行p;第三行空着;第四行空着;第五行w
在这里插入图片描述

在这里插入图片描述

(2)fdisk /dev/sdb < part.txt
在这里插入图片描述
在这里插入图片描述

总结

今天的学习更多的是要手动操作去理解,多实践操作才能熟练掌握此内容,赶快动手实践起来吧。

  • 5
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值